// The backing store for hints, which is responsible for storing all hints
// locally on-device. While the HintCache itself may retain some hints in a
// memory cache, all of its hints are initially loaded asynchronously by the
// store. All calls to this store must be made from the same thread.
class OptimizationGuideStore {
public:
using HintLoadedCallback =
base::OnceCallback<void(const std::string&, std::unique_ptr<MemoryHint>)>;
using EntryKey = std::string;
using StoreEntryProtoDatabase =
leveldb_proto::ProtoDatabase<proto::StoreEntry>;
// Status of the store. The store begins in kUninitialized, transitions to
// kInitializing after Initialize() is called, and transitions to kAvailable
// if initialization successfully completes. In the case where anything fails,
// the store transitions to kFailed, at which point it is fully purged and
// becomes unusable.
//
// Keep in sync with OptimizationGuideHintCacheLevelDBStoreStatus in
// tools/metrics/histograms/enums.xml.
enum class Status {
kUninitialized = 0,
kInitializing = 1,
kAvailable = 2,
kFailed = 3,
kMaxValue = kFailed,
};
// Store entry types within the store appear at the start of the keys of
// entries. These values are converted into strings within the key: a key
// starting with "1_" signifies a metadata entry and one starting with "2_"
// signifies a component hint entry. Adding this to the start of the key
// allows the store to quickly perform operations on all entries of a specific
// key type. Given that store entry type comparisons may be performed many
// times, the entry type string is kept as small as possible.
// Example metadata entry type key:
// "[StoreEntryType::kMetadata]_[MetadataType::kSchema]" ==> "1_1"
// Example component hint store entry type key:
// "[StoreEntryType::kComponentHint]_[component_version]_[host]"
// ==> "2_55_foo.com"
// NOTE: The order and value of the existing store entry types within the enum
// cannot be changed, but new types can be added to the end.
// StoreEntryType should remain synchronized with the
// HintCacheStoreEntryType in enums.xml.
enum class StoreEntryType {
kEmpty = 0,
kMetadata = 1,
kComponentHint = 2,
kFetchedHint = 3,
kPredictionModel = 4,
kDeprecatedHostModelFeatures = 5, // deprecated.
kMaxValue = kDeprecatedHostModelFeatures,
};

// Initializes the store. If |purge_existing_data| is set to true,
// then the cache is purged during initialization and starts in a fresh state.
// When initialization completes, the provided callback is run asynchronously.
// Virtualized for testing.
virtual void Initialize(bool purge_existing_data, base::OnceClosure callback);
// Creates and returns a StoreUpdateData object for component hints. This
// object is used to collect hints within a component in a format usable on a
// background thread and is later returned to the store in
// UpdateComponentHints(). The StoreUpdateData object is only created when the
// provided component version is newer than the store's version, indicating
// fresh hints. If the component's version is not newer than the store's
// version, then no StoreUpdateData is created and nullptr is returned. This
// prevents unnecessary processing of the component's hints by the caller.
std::unique_ptr<StoreUpdateData> MaybeCreateUpdateDataForComponentHints(
const base::Version& version) const;
// Creates and returns a HintsUpdateData object for Fetched Hints.
// This object is used to collect a batch of hints in a format that is usable
// to update the store on a background thread. This is always created when
// hints have been successfully fetched from the remote Optimization Guide
// Service so the store can expire old hints, remove hints specified by the
// server, and store the fresh hints.
std::unique_ptr<StoreUpdateData> CreateUpdateDataForFetchedHints(
base::Time update_time) const;
// Updates the component hints and version contained within the store. When
// this is called, all pre-existing component hints within the store is purged
// and only the new hints are retained. After the store is fully updated with
// the new component hints, the callback is run asynchronously.
void UpdateComponentHints(std::unique_ptr<StoreUpdateData> component_data,
base::OnceClosure callback);
// Updates the fetched hints contained in the store, including the
// metadata entry. The callback is run asynchronously after the database
// stores the hints.
void UpdateFetchedHints(std::unique_ptr<StoreUpdateData> fetched_hints_data,
base::OnceClosure callback);
// Removes fetched hint store entries from |this|. |entry_keys_| is
// updated after the fetched hint entries are removed.
void ClearFetchedHintsFromDatabase();
// Finds the most specific hint entry key for the specified host. Returns
// true if a hint entry key is found, in which case |out_hint_entry_key| is
// populated with the key. All keys for kFetched hints are considered before
// kComponent hints as they are updated more frequently.
bool FindHintEntryKey(const std::string& host,
EntryKey* out_hint_entry_key) const;
// Loads the hint specified by |hint_entry_key|.
// After the load finishes, the hint data is passed to |callback|. In the case
// where the hint cannot be loaded, the callback is run with a nullptr.
// Depending on the load result, the callback may be synchronous or
// asynchronous.
void LoadHint(const EntryKey& hint_entry_key, HintLoadedCallback callback);
// Returns the time that the fetched hints in the store can be updated. If
// |this| is not available, base::Time() is returned.
base::Time GetFetchedHintsUpdateTime() const;
// Removes all fetched hints that have expired from the store.
// |entry_keys_| is updated after the expired fetched hints are
// removed.
void PurgeExpiredFetchedHints();
// Removes fetched hints whose keys are in |hint_keys| and runs |on_success|
// if successful, otherwise the callback is not run.
void RemoveFetchedHintsByKey(base::OnceClosure on_success,
const base::flat_set<std::string>& hint_keys);
// Returns true if the current status is Status::kAvailable.
bool IsAvailable() const;
// Returns the weak ptr of |this|.
base::WeakPtr<OptimizationGuideStore> AsWeakPtr() {
return weak_ptr_factory_.GetWeakPtr();
}
